Transaction 93cd62b5f97b241e821aa71b054310c4f44f7ffbcb1e9ab7f39ce20aab6c8638
1 Input
2 Outputs
- 93cd62b5f97b241e821aa71b054310c4f44f7ffbcb1e9ab7f39ce20aab6c8638:0
- 93cd62b5f97b241e821aa71b054310c4f44f7ffbcb1e9ab7f39ce20aab6c8638:1
value 7162235
address 1FdWwgHPXj9rjxHvyDNBjTBdy4P6BywWsn
value 110963
address 3CWMphgTq67NhKM9fgiSCcZLmZyMc1Dx8t